First Brands Group has expanded its line of Centric Parts brake components to include 86 new friction and rotor parts covering popular cars, light trucks and SUVs.

The just-released Centric part numbers consist of friction coverage for late-model vehicles, including Genesis G70, Hyundai Kona, and Kia Seltos and Stinger. In addition, Centric rotors are now available for late model Cadillac CTS; Chevrolet Camaro and Tracker; Honda Accord, Civic and CR-V; Suzuki Vitara; and Toyota Highlander.

“We are pleased to add new friction and rotor coverage and expand our family of Centric braking part applications,” said Lou Kafantaris, Director of Marketing, Braking, First Brands Group. “The new friction and rotor part numbers cover over 23-million vehicles in operation (VIO).”

The complete family of Centric brake products include disc pads and shoes, drums and rotors, master cylinders, wheel cylinders, calipers, hoses and hardware. To learn more about the new part numbers and applications, customers should contact their First Brands Group representative.
